Industries' Descriptions

@Computer Communications (-6.88% weekly)

Computer communications industry develops technology that allows computing devices to exchange data with each other using connections/data links between nodes. Common types of computer network include Cloud (IAN), Internet, Wide (WAN, Local (LAN)/Wireless(WLAN) etc. The industry is an ever-more important part of technology, and is set to become even bigger as the Internet of Things (IoT) rapidly forays into the various aspects of our lives. Cisco Systems, Inc., Palo Alto Networks, Inc. and Arista Networks, Inc., Fortinet, Inc. are some of the major computer communications companies.

FUNDAMENTALS
Fundamentals
FFIV($15.7B) has a higher market cap than GEN($14.1B). GEN has higher P/E ratio than FFIV: GEN (25.20) vs FFIV (22.89). FFIV YTD gains are higher at: 8.317 vs. GEN (-15.668). GEN has higher annual earnings (EBITDA): 2.06B vs. FFIV (884M). FFIV has more cash in the bank: 1.34B vs. GEN (691M). FFIV has less debt than GEN: FFIV (262M) vs GEN (8.7B). GEN has higher revenues than FFIV: GEN (4.47B) vs FFIV (3.09B).
